xfs: test zone stream separation for two buffered writers
authorChristoph Hellwig <hch@lst.de>
Fri, 22 Nov 2024 17:19:49 +0000 (18:19 +0100)
committerChristoph Hellwig <hch@lst.de>
Thu, 30 Jan 2025 05:52:05 +0000 (06:52 +0100)
Check that two parallel buffered sequential writers are separated into
different zones when writeback happens before closing the files.

diff --git a/tests/xfs/4208 b/tests/xfs/4208
new file mode 100755 (executable)
index 0000000..b851057
--- /dev/null
@@ -0,0 +1,79 @@
+#! /bin/bash
+# S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0
+# Copyright (c) 2024 Christoph Hellwig.
+#
+# FS QA Test No. 4208
+#
+# Test that multiple buffered I/O write streams are directed to separate zones
+# when written back with the file still open.
+#
+. ./common/preamble
+_begin_fstest quick auto rw zone
+
+_cleanup()
+{
+       cd /
+       _scratch_unmount >/dev/null 2>&1
+}
+
+# Import common functions.
+. ./common/filter
+
+_require_scratch
+
+_filter_rgno()
+{
+       # the rg number is in column 4 of xfs_bmap output
+       perl -ne '
+               $rg = (split /\s+/)[4] ;
+               if ($rg =~ /\d+/) {print "$rg "} ;
+       '
+}
+
+_scratch_mkfs_xfs >>$seqres.full 2>&1
+_scratch_mount
+_require_xfs_scratch_zoned 3
+
+fio_config=$tmp.fio
+fio_out=$tmp.fio.out
+fio_err=$tmp.fio.err
+
+cat >$fio_config <<EOF
+[global]
+bs=64k
+iodepth=16
+iodepth_batch=8
+size=1m
+directory=$SCRATCH_MNT
+rw=write
+fsync_on_close=1
+
+[file1]
+filename=file1
+size=128m
+
+[file2]
+filename=file2
+size=128m
+EOF
+
+_require_fio $fio_config
+
+$FIO_PROG $fio_config --output=$fio_out
+cat $fio_out >> $seqres.full
+
+# Check the files only have a single extent each and are in separate zones
+extents1=$(_count_extents $SCRATCH_MNT/file1)
+extents2=$(_count_extents $SCRATCH_MNT/file2)
+
+echo "number of file 1 extents: $extents1"
+echo "number of file 2 extents: $extents2"
+
+rg1=`xfs_bmap -v $SCRATCH_MNT/file1 | _filter_rgno`
+rg2=`xfs_bmap -v $SCRATCH_MNT/file2 | _filter_rgno`
+if [ "${rg1}" == "${rg2}" ]; then
+       echo "same RG used for both files"
+fi
+
+status=0
+exit
